What is libbasix-dev
libbasix-dev is:
Computes FE basis functions and derivatives for the following elements:
- Lagrange (interval, triangle, tetrahedron, prism, pyramid, quadrilateral, hexahedron)
- N?d?lec (triangle, tetrahedron)
- N?d?lec Second Kind (triangle, tetrahedron)
- Raviart-Thomas (triangle, tetrahedron)
- Regge (triangle, tetrahedron)
- Crouzeix-Raviart (triangle, tetrahedron)
Computes quadrature rules on different cell types
Provides reference topology and geometry for reference cells of each type.
Python wrapper provided with pybind11.
This package installs the development files for the shared library.
There are three methods to install libbasix-dev on Debian 12.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.
Install libbasix-dev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install libbasix-dev using apt-get by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install libbasix-dev
Install libbasix-dev Using apt
Update apt database with apt using the following command.
sudo apt update
After updating apt database, We can install libbasix-dev using apt by running the following command:
sudo apt -y install libbasix-dev
Install libbasix-dev Using aptitude
If you want to follow this method, you might need to install aptitude first since aptitude is usually not installed by default on Debian. Update apt database with aptitude using the following command.
sudo aptitude update
After updating apt database, We can install libbasix-dev using aptitude by running the following command:
sudo aptitude -y install libbasix-dev
